NEW CITY, N.Y. (AP) — Former NFL star Lawrence Taylor is scheduled to be sentenced in a suburban New York court today for having sex with an underage girl.

The 51-year-old ex-linebacker already has worked out a plea deal of six years' probation. He'll also be required to register as a sex offender.

Taylor says he paid $300 to have sex with the 16-year-old runaway he had thought was a 19-year-old prostitute. Taylor had resisted a plea deal for months, saying the girl had lied about her age.

The prosecutor says the plea deal is acceptable because Taylor has helped in investigations into human trafficking since he was charged.

Taylor led the New York Giants to Super Bowl titles in 1987 and 1991.
